The state of Arizona has passed a tax reform bill that taxes property owners at a specified rate with the exception of mines and utilities.Both mines and utilities are assigned a higher rate of tax for their properties.A state legislator commented on the bill,"In some of these small towns,without the higher rate of taxation for mines and utilities,the schools in these towns would suffer because the property is worth nothing and there are no property tax dollars coming in.We have to tax these area's wealthiest citizens at a different rate and those citizens happen to be the mining companies and the public utilities." Is the tax constitutional?
